Shingles replacement is a crucial aspect of maintaining the integrity and longevity of your home's roof. Over time, shingles can become damaged due to weather conditions, such as heavy rain, snow, and wind, or simply due to aging. Damaged shingles can lead to leaks, which may cause significant damage to the interior of your home, including the insulation and structural components. By replacing shingles promptly, you can prevent these issues and ensure that your roof continues to protect your home effectively. This proactive approach not only helps in preserving the aesthetic appeal of your house but also can potentially save you from costly repairs in the future. Regular maintenance and timely replacement of shingles are key to safeguarding your investment and maintaining the value of your property.
Benefits of Shingles Replacement
-
Enhanced Protection
Replacing old or damaged shingles provides enhanced protection against the elements. New shingles are more likely to withstand harsh weather conditions,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age. This improved protection ensures that your home remains safe and secure, even during severe weather events. -
Increased Home Value
Updating your roof with new shingles can significantly increase the value of your home. A well-maintained roof is an attractive feature for potential buyers, as it indicates that the property has been cared for and is less likely to require immediate repairs. This can make your home more appealing in a competitive real estate market. -
Improved Energy Efficiency
New shingles can improve your home's energy efficiency by providing better insulation. This can help in maintaining a consistent indoor temperature, reducing the need for excessive heating or cooling. As a result, you may experience lower energy bills, making shingles replacement a cost-effective home improvement project.
